Approaches for online anxiety and life-change work

Client-centered therapy focuses on the person's goals and values. It means the therapist follows what matters most to the client, listens closely, and helps the person set their own pace for change. This approach is helpful for building self-worth and exploring identity concerns.

Cognitive behavioral therapy, or CBT, looks at the link between thoughts, feelings, and actions. It involves noticing unhelpful thinking patterns, testing new ways of thinking, and practicing behaviors that reduce anxiety or low mood. CBT is useful for stress, anxiety, and mood-related problems.

Choosing the right way of working is part of therapy. The therapist will talk with the person about needs, goals, and preferences and will try approaches that fit. That collaborative process makes it easier to adjust methods over time if something isn't helping.

Online sessions can include video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or text-based messaging. Video lets people read facial cues and hold a more traditional conversation. Phone sessions use less bandwidth and can be a quick option for a check-in. Live chat or messaging can be used for shorter check-ins, between-session support, or when writing helps clarify thoughts. These options aim to make therapy more flexible and easier to fit into a busy life.
